The US Highway Department renumberd US Highway 666 to US Highway 491 because of the superstitions surrounding that number and because people kept stealing the road signs. ![]() The route is from Gallup, New Mexico on I-40 in NW New Mexico, into SW Colorado through Cortez, then into SE Utah to Monticello.
